What does a billing collection analyst do?

A billing collection analyst is responsible for managing accounts receivable by following up on overdue payments, resolving billing discrepancies, and ensuring timely collection of outstanding balances. They often use accounting software and communicate with clients or internal teams to improve cash flow and reduce bad debt. Strong attention to detail and knowledge of financial regulations are essential for this role.

Job description

A large global law firm seeks a Legal Billing Compliance Analyst to join their team. This position is responsible for the review of Outside Counsel Guidelines to ensure that billing is compliant with the expectations of their clients. This will include invoice review, timekeeping training for attorneys and staff, assist in preparation of budgets, and overall analysis of client economics. Excellent communication skills are required to effectively manage all billing matters with partners, clients, and staff as this position will provide recommendations and advice. The Legal Billing Analyst should have knowledge of legal terms and processes in order to effectively manage the client billing.
Responsibilities:
  • Reviews Outside Counsel Guidelines and prepares a summary that is distributed to all timekeepers working for the client.
  • Trains timekeepers to adhere to the guidelines, which includes a review of proper narrative etiquette, expense allowances, and proper task and activity code usage.
  • Customizes and coordinates best practice procedures to ensure a smooth billing process for the partners and clients.
  • Prepares reports and analyses as requested.
  • Reviews inventory regularly to abide by billing deadlines to minimize the billing and collections cycle.
  • Acts as liaison between clients, partners and assistants when issues arise that require follow-up to address client's needs and provide resolution.
  • Coordinates the efforts of internal staff, vendor staff and client's designated personnel.
  •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ree is preferred. Accounting or Business major highly desirable.
  • Must have 3 -5 years of law firm e-billing experience.
  • Proficient with various e-billing protocols, vendors and the e-Billing Hub. Prior experience with third party e-billing software is preferred.
  • Must be familiar with best practices for billing/collection in the legal industry.
  • Must have the ability to effectively communicate with all levels of personnel, have excellent attention to detail and the ability to work well under pressure.
  • Outstanding written and verbal communications skills, excellent organizational skills and the ability to strategize, multi-task and prioritize.
